Dick Williams 1892 - 1970

Dick Williams of Lawrence, Douglas County, Kansas was born on May 7, 1892, and died at age 78 years old in June 1970.

  • Military Service

    Military serial#: 00313904 Enlisted: September 20, 1940 in Ft Leavenworth Kansas Military branch: Cavalry Private First Class Regular Army (including Officers, Nurses, Warrant Officers, And Enlisted Men) Terms of enlistment: Enlistment For The Philippine Department
